Mr. Manuel Bompard draws the attention of the Minister Delegate to the Minister for Ecological Transition and Territorial Cohesion, responsible for transport, to the region-region and region-Europe night trains. The public authorities have relaunched several night trains from Paris, thus providing necessary service for the southern regions of the metropolitan territory. However, this is not enough to meet the needs residents of these regions. For example, residents of the South - Provence-Alpes-Côte d'Azur region need to go to Strasbourg, Nancy, Metz, Lille, Brussels, Nantes or Bordeaux just as much as they do to Paris. In addition, it is over these distances that train travel times are the longest. The trip often consumes a full day. Furthermore, journeys often involve a compulsory connection, which leaves the fear of not being able to arrive at your destination before the end of the day in the event of a delay of one of the trains and a breakdown in the connection. The night train is therefore relevant for regaining connectivity in the metropolitan area by rail. The 2021 report on territorial balance trains (TET) showed the relevance of relaunching night trains on certain region-region routes. However many crossbars are missing. For example, the Nice-Marseille-Bordeaux-La Rochelle-Nantes night train alone would reconnect 10% of the metropolitan population. He asks him if the Government intends to complete the plan proposed by the TET report in particular to better connect all the regions together and connect them to the Member States of the European Union.
